Essential Maintenance Tips for Your Fume Extractor
Maintaining the KINGSOM Solder Fume Extractor is essential for peak performance and longevity, guaranteeing that it continues to effectively capture harmful fumes and particles during various applications.
Regular filter replacement is critical; the extractor utilizes a 2-in-1 HEPA and activated carbon filter that requires changing approximately every 3-6 months, depending on usage.
Users should also perform airflow adjustment checks, as ideal suction levels enhance fume capture efficiency.
Keeping the unit clean and free from dust will further improve functionality.
